Output 86e4d5361f9fb917fb2ce51a60ab6d8ab1a90479fc4ce9518c53c6e674ef7773:0

value
34829331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c77106f3ac19c9088efb6f7181ca609ec89994a OP_EQUAL
address
35k8Hi7qfz5cj7guH1BR9g3N4fAD6s23hb
transaction
86e4d5361f9fb917fb2ce51a60ab6d8ab1a90479fc4ce9518c53c6e674ef7773
confirmations
321764
spent
true